GPT Engineerの使用方法:AI駆動型ウェブ開発ガイド

AI駆動型ウェブ開発のためにGPT Engineerを活用する方法を発見しましょう。包括的なガイドで、セットアップ、使用のヒント、ベストプラクティスを学びます。

George Foster
更新日 2024年09月28日
目次

    GPT Engineerの紹介

    GPT Engineerは、自然言語の仕様に基づいてコードを生成することで、ソフトウェア開発プロセスを効率化するように設計された革新的なAI駆動ツールです。ユーザーは、構築したいものを簡単な言葉で説明でき、必要に応じてAIが明確化を求め、その後コードベースの構築に進みます。このツールは、コードの品質を犠牲にすることなく、ワークフローを加速したい開発者にとって特に有用です。

    このプラットフォームは、さまざまなプログラミング言語とフレームワークをサポートしており、異なるプロジェクト要件に対して汎用性があります。GPT Engineerは適応性も考慮されており、ユーザーがAIの出力を自分のコーディングスタイルやプロジェクトの特性に合わせてカスタマイズできるようになっています。高度なAIモデルを活用することで、GPT Engineerはソフトウェア開発を民主化し、非技術者や迅速かつ効率的にアイデアを実現したいチームにとってより身近なものにすることを目指しています。

    GPT Engineer
    GPT Engineer
    GPTエンジニアは、ユーザーが自然言語のプロンプトとチャットインタラクションを通じてフルスタックアプリケーションを作成できるAI駆動のウェブアプリビルダーです。
    ウェブサイトを訪問

    GPT Engineerのユースケース

    1. 迅速なWebアプリプロトタイピング:
    GPT Engineerは、自然言語の説明を機能的なWebアプリケーションに素早く変換することに優れています。この機能は、広範なコーディングなしでアイデアを検証したいスタートアップや開発者にとって非常に価値があります。チャットインターフェースで必要な機能とデザインを指定するだけで、通常の開発時間のほんの一部で、レビューと反復のためのプロトタイプを準備できます。

    2. カスタムダッシュボードの作成:
    カスタマイズされた運用ダッシュボードを必要とする企業向けに、GPT Engineerは主要な指標とデータの可視化を表示する直感的なインターフェースを生成できます。このユースケースは、複数のデータストリームを管理し、情報に基づいた意思決定を行うためにリアルタイムの洞察を必要とするスタートアップにとって特に有益です。

    3. 教育ツールの開発:
    教育者や開発者は、GPT Engineerを活用してインタラクティブな教育ツールやプラットフォームを作成できます。学習目標と望ましい対話性を記述することで、GPT Engineerは魅力的でパーソナライズされた体験を通じて学習を促進するアプリケーションを生成できます。

    4. パーソナルアシスタントアプリ:
    GPT Engineerは、ユーザーがタスク、リマインダー、スケジュールを管理するのを助けるパーソナルアシスタントアプリケーションの構築に長けています。支援の範囲とユーザーとの対話を定義することで、開発者は生産性と組織力を向上させるアプリを迅速に展開できます。

    5. ポートフォリオとランディングページの生成:
    フリーランサーや小規模ビジネスのために、GPT Engineerは迅速にプロフェッショナルなポートフォリオウェブサイトやランディングページを生成できます。プロジェクトの詳細やブランディング要素を入力することで、広範なWeb開発スキルを必要とせずに洗練されたオンラインプレゼンスを持つことができます。

    6. 内部ツールの開発:
    企業はGPT Engineerを使用して、ワークフローを効率化し、運用効率を向上させる内部ツールを迅速に開発できます。データ入力フォームやレポート生成ツールなど、必要な機能を指定することで、企業は特定のニーズに合わせたカスタムツールを展開できます。

    GPT Engineerのユーザー要件を迅速に具体的なWebアプリケーションに変換する能力は、さまざまなセクターにとって強力なツールとなり、より迅速な開発サイクルと市場需要へのより機敏な対応を可能にします。

    GPT Engineerへのアクセス方法

    1. 公式ウェブサイトにアクセス:https://gptengineer.app/ にアクセスしてGPT Engineerプラットフォームを利用します。これはAI駆動のWebアプリビルダーの使用を開始できる主要なポータルです。
    2. アカウントを作成:サインアップまたはログインボタンをクリックしてアカウントを作成します。通常、有効なメールアドレスの提供とパスワードの設定が必要です。このステップにより、プラットフォームの機能にパーソナライズされたアクセスが確保されます。
    3. APIキーを入力:ログイン後、OpenAI APIキーを入力する必要があります。このキーは、プラットフォームがWebアプリケーションの生成にOpenAIの強力な言語モデルを利用するために重要です。
    4. 構築を開始:アカウントの設定とAPIキーの入力が完了したら、提供されたテキストボックスに構築したいものを指定し始めることができます。自然言語を使用してWebアプリの要件を説明してください。
    5. レビューとデプロイ:プロジェクトの説明後、AIがコードを生成します。生成されたコードをレビューし、必要な調整を行います。満足したら、ワンクリックでWebアプリをデプロイし、ライブで利用可能にすることができます。

    これらの手順に従うことで、GPT Engineerを効率的に活用して、迅速かつ直感的にWebアプリケーションを構築できます。

    GPT Engineerの使用方法

    1. GPT Engineerのインストール:

    • 安定版リリース: python -m pip install gpt-engineerを実行して、最新の安定版をインストールします。
    • 開発版: git clone https://github.com/gpt-engineer-org/gpt-engineer.gitを使用してリポジトリをクローンし、ディレクトリに移動してpoetry installpoetry shellで仮想環境をアクティベートします。

    2. APIキーの設定:

    • 環境変数: export OPENAI_API_KEY=[your api key]を使用してOpenAI APIキーをエクスポートします。
    • .envファイル: プロジェクトディレクトリに.envファイルを作成し、OPENAI_API_KEY=[your api key]を追加します。

    3. 新しいプロジェクトの作成:

    • 空のフォルダ: プロジェクト用の空のフォルダを作成します。
    • プロンプトファイル: フォルダ内にpromptファイルを作成し、自然言語で構築したいものを説明します。

    4. GPT Engineerの実行:

    • デフォルトの使用法: gpte を実行して、プロンプトに基づいたAI駆動のコード生成を開始します。
    • 既存のコードの改善: 既存のコードがあり、新しいプロンプトに基づいてAIに改善してもらいたい場合はgpte -iを使用します。

    5. プリプロンプトのカスタマイズ(オプション):

    • アイデンティティのカスタマイズ: prepromptsフォルダを独自のバージョンで上書きして、AIの動作とコーディングスタイルをカスタマイズします。カスタマイズを適用するには--use-custom-preprompts引数を使用します。

    これらの手順に従うことで、AI駆動のコード生成を使用して、GPT Engineerを活用してソフトウェアプロジェクトを迅速にプロトタイプ化し開発できます。

    GPT Engineerでアカウントを作成する方法

    GPT Engineerでアカウントを作成するには、以下の手順に従ってください:

    1. GPT Engineerのウェブサイトにアクセス:GPT Engineerにアクセスします。これはAIを使用してWebアプリを構築できる公式プラットフォームです。
    2. サインアップページに移動:通常、ホームページの右上隅にある「アカウント作成」または「サインアップ」リンクを探します。これをクリックすると登録ページに移動します。
    3. 詳細を入力:メールアドレス、ユーザー名、パスワードなどの必要な情報を入力します。アカウントを保護するために、強力で一意のパスワードを使用してください。
    4. メールを確認:詳細を送信した後、GPT Engineerから送信された確認リンクをメールで確認します。リンクをクリックしてアカウントを確認します。このステップはアカウントを有効にし、セキュリティを確保するために重要です。
    5. ログイン:メールが確認されたら、GPT Engineerのウェブサイトに戻り、新しく作成した認証情報を使用してログインします。これにより、プラットフォームの機能とサービスにアクセスできるようになります。

    これらの手順に従うことで、GPT Engineerでアカウントを正常に作成し、AIの支援を受けてWebアプリケーションの構築を開始できるようになります。

    GPT Engineerを使用するためのヒント

    GPT Engineerは、自然言語を使用した迅速なWebアプリ開発のための強力なツールです。この革新的なプラットフォームを最大限に活用するために、以下のヒントを考慮してください:

    1. コンテキストに基づいたプロンプト:プロジェクトの明確なコンテキストを提供することから始めます。これにより、GPT Engineerはアプリケーションの範囲と特定のニーズを理解し、より正確で関連性の高いコード生成につながります。
    2. 段階的なプロンプト:複雑な単一のプロンプトでシステムに負担をかけるのではなく、リクエストをより小さく管理しやすいプロンプトに分割します。このアプローチにより、より正確な調整と改善が可能になります。
    3. 画像プロンプトの使用:プロジェクトに視覚的な要素が含まれる場合は、画像プロンプトを使用してAIをガイドします。これはUI/UXデザインに特に有用で、生成されたコードが視覚的な期待に合致することを確認できます。
    4. 具体的に:曖昧さを避けるために要件を明確に表現します。具体的なプロンプトは、より的確で有用な結果をもたらします。
    5. 制約の追加:特定の制限や要件(パフォーマンスベンチマークやデザイン制約など)がある場合は、それらをプロンプトに含めてAIを効果的にガイドします。

    これらのヒントに従うことで、ユーザーはGPT Engineerとの対話を強化し、より効率的で成功したプロジェクト成果につながります。

    関連記事

    あなたに最適なAIツールを簡単に見つけられます。
    今すぐ探す!
    製品データ統合
    豊富な選択肢
    豊富な情報